Common Uses of Identifiers Like ICIMA
Let's break down some common scenarios where identifiers similar to ICIMA pop up. In the world of product manufacturing, unique codes are essential for tracking inventory, managing warranties, and ensuring quality control. Think about it: every time you buy a product, it has a serial number or a model number that identifies it uniquely. This allows the manufacturer to track its production history, identify any potential defects, and provide targeted support to customers. In the software industry, identifiers are used to manage different versions of software, track bug fixes, and ensure compatibility with various operating systems. Each software release has a version number or a build number that distinguishes it from previous versions. This helps developers and users alike to keep track of changes and ensure that they're using the correct version of the software. Identifiers are also crucial in the realm of data management. When organizations collect vast amounts of data, they need ways to organize and categorize it. Unique identifiers are used to label data sets, track data lineage, and ensure data integrity. This allows data analysts to easily find and analyze the data they need, and it helps organizations comply with data privacy regulations. In the world of scientific research, identifiers are used to track experiments, manage data, and ensure reproducibility. Each experiment has a unique identifier that allows researchers to easily find and analyze the data associated with it. This is essential for ensuring the integrity of scientific research and for allowing other researchers to replicate the findings. Identifiers also play a crucial role in healthcare. They are used to identify patients, track medical records, and manage prescriptions. This helps healthcare providers ensure that they're providing the right treatment to the right patient at the right time. So, as you can see, identifiers like ICIMA are used in a wide variety of industries and applications. They are essential for tracking, managing, and organizing information, and they play a crucial role in ensuring efficiency, accuracy, and compliance.
